Description

À seulement 10 minutes à pied de l'Horloge de Tassin-la-Demi-Lune, Avenir Investissement a le plaisir de vous présenter cette superbe demeure familiale de 250 m², érigée sur une parcelle paysagée de 833 m². Entre cachet de l'ancien et élégance contemporaine, cette propriété conjugue authenticité, confort et raffinement dans un environnement privilégié, à la fois calme et proche de toutes commodités.<br>Dès l'entrée, le charme opère. Les volumes généreux, la hauteur sous plafond et la lumière omniprésente créent une atmosphère à la fois chaleureuse et inspirante. Le séjour baigné de lumière, ouvert sur le jardin et la terrasse, offre une continuité naturelle entre intérieur et extérieur, propice aux moments de convivialité. La pièce de vie centrale, spacieuse et accueillante, s'articule autour d'une cuisine moderne et fonctionnelle, pensée pour rassembler famille et amis dans un esprit de partage.<br>Les étages abritent plusieurs chambres spacieuses et modulables, bureau, salle de jeux .<br>Érigée en 1907, la maison a été sublimée par une extension contemporaine entièrement vitrée, conçue par un architecte, qui vient magnifier la structure d'origine. Le mariage subtil entre matériaux nobles et lignes modernes confère à l'ensemble une harmonie rare et intemporelle.<br>Un jardin arboré, une terrasse ensoleillée, un garage, une buanderie et une cave complètent ce bien d'exception.<br>Alliant charme, lumière et caractère, cette maison unique séduit par sa personnalité affirmée et ses possibilités multiples d'aménagement, offrant à ses futurs propriétaires un cadre de vie d'une rare qualité. Visa

Talent Passport (Passeport Talent) — multiple categories for skilled workers, entrepreneurs, and researchers. Qualified employee route requires min €39,582/yr salary. Valid up to 4 years, family included. Visitor Visa (Visa Long Séjour) suits retirees with passive income — no work allowed, must prove €1,600+/mo resources.

Cost of buying in France

Estimated fees and ongoing costs for this property

Closing Costs

7-10% of purchase price

  • ·Notary fees: 7-8% (includes transfer taxes)
  • ·Agent: 3-8% (usually included in listing price)
  • ·No separate stamp duty

Annual Costs

Property Tax

€500-3,000+/yr taxe foncière (varies by commune)

Insurance

€200-500/yr

HOA / Condo Fees

€100-300/mo for apartments (charges de copropriété)

Good to Know

Agent Fees

Usually seller pays (included in listing price)

Foreign Buyer Note

No restrictions on foreign buyers. Non-residents pay 3% additional wealth tax on French property above €1.3M.
